429MHz LoRa wireless module

8-point communication is also possible. LPWA wireless module that enables long-distance transmission.

The "SLR-429M" is an embedded wireless module designed for ease of use. In addition to the LoRa mode, which enables ultra-long-range communication at low bit rates, it also features a conventional FSK mode. It achieves LPWA via LoRa with a completely proprietary protocol in the 429MHz band, which is designed solely for circuit applications. The 429MHz band has superior diffraction characteristics compared to the 920MHz band, allowing for stable communication in various environments such as indoors, mountainous areas, along rivers, and underground. It connects to external microcontrollers or PCs via a UART interface. This is a specific low-power wireless module that requires no license and incurs no communication fees. 【Features】 ■ Communication distance: over 10km line of sight ■ Communication speed: 245bps ■ Capable of communication with up to 8 contact points ■ Superior diffraction characteristics compared to the 920MHz band *You can purchase directly from the related links. Long-range wireless module "OZV3"

Achieving low power consumption! This product features two modes: long-distance communication and high-speed communication.

The "OZV3" is an original module for LPWA communication in the 920MHz band. It is specialized for long-distance communication, albeit at low speeds. It comes with an original stack and can be easily controlled via serial commands from microcontrollers or PCs. Depending on the application, you can choose between long-distance mode and high-speed mode. In long-distance mode, it achieves a communication range of 10 km in line of sight. (Transmission speed: 0.2 to 6 kbps; 10 km is at 0.2 kbps) Additionally, it complies with ARIB STD-T108 and has obtained construction design certification for domestic use. 【Features】 ■ Compact stacking module suitable for embedding ■ Easy control via serial commands from microcontrollers or PCs ■ Two selectable modes: long-distance and high-speed ■ Supports three types of antennas (coaxial cable: minor certification required) - IPX connector - SMA connector - Direct attachment of coaxial cable *For more details, please refer to the PDF documentation or feel free to contact us.
